Cowley Manor
Cowley Manor
Timelessly stylish, Cowley Manor is the original contemporary boutique hotel.
With a grand Italianate exterior and bold iconic interiors, this is the perfect choice for couples, families, and groups alike. Featuring 30 bedrooms, a multi award-winning spa including heated indoor & outdoor pools, locally sourced food, and 55 acres of Grade II listed gardens, Cowley Manor is the perfect place for a luxury getaway in the Cotswolds.
Located by the regency spa town of Cheltenham, Cowley Manor makes an ideal base to explore the Cotswolds – you’ll find us just 15 minutes from Cirencester and 20 minutes from Stow-on-the-Wold. The quintessential Cotswold chocolate-box village of Cowley itself, with its honey-hued buildings and inspiring views, is the perfect starting point for a countryside walk (with some great pubs on the way!).
Spoil yourself with an afternoon tea, bring the family for lunch in our restaurant, or enjoy dinner al fresco on the terrace overlooking our beautiful gardens – the choice is yours.
Reviews
There are no reviews yet. Be the first one to write one.
Rate and write a review
We are passionate about the local community and its businesses so please note that reviews will only be published if constructive and well-intended.